Description

This paper presents the design of a compact and efficient rectangular waveguide TE10 to circular waveguide TE01 mode converter operating in the X-band. By incorporating a choke slot structure, the design achieves a high-purity circular waveguide TE01 mode, aiming to enhance the overall performance of SLED microwave pulse compression systems. The converter was designed and optimized using HFSS software. The optimized results show that at the operating frequency of 11.424 GHz, the conversion efficiency for the circular waveguide TE01 mode is calculated to be approximately 100%, with negligible reflection. The bandwidth reaches more than 200 MHz for the transmission coefficient while the bandwidth is approximately 24 MHz for the reflection coefficient better than -40 dB.
